what is a conventional mortgage For example, FHA borrowers may transition to a conventional loan in order to eliminate mortgage insurance while getting a great rate. Another key benefit of a conventional loan is its flexibility to be applied to many different kinds of properties. Conventional loans can be used to finance a primary residence, a second home, or a rental property.

All borrowers that have a USDA loan are required to pay an annual fee. The amount of the fee is added to the monthly payment amount, similar to the funds that are designated for property taxes and home insurance. The fee amount that is paid each month will change from year to year.
